Learn Some Basic Student Loan Information Before Applying
Getting a loan has become a very easy process, and student loans are no exception. The repayment process is substantially more difficult, however. For that reason, you should understand some basic information about student loans before you get one yourself.
Student Loan Information: What You Should Know
Before you apply for any student loan, be sure to ask yourself some important questions that will help you to make a well thought out decision. Start by asking, How much financial aid do I really need? and then What plan do I have to pay this loan back successfully?
Other important student loan information would be what the eligibility criteria for the loan are; where best you could apply for the loan; what is the time gap between the sanction of the loan and the repayment schedule of the loan; are there possibilities to earn while studying, etc.
As you can see these are questions whose answers make up the student loan information on the basis of which you would know whether it is okay to apply for that financial assistance or not. These questions would also tell you whether the process would be smooth or rough. As you answer to these questions you would understand what you should be prepared for and how to work out your way not only to avail of the loan, but most importantly for its repayment.
The Repayment Conditions ??" A Very Important Often Ignored Student Loan Information
Statistics have shown that roughly six out of every ten college students in the United States have incurred serious debt because of student loans and the irresponsible use of credit cards that they have to start paying after graduation. A bad credit history or score is not something that anyone wants to deal with when they are starting out with a brand new career, family, or both.
In order to avoid such unpleasant circumstances, you need to plan out how you will repay your student loan debt now. Even though making good financial choices is not easy when you are young, it is worth putting forth the effort to do. Contact your school for debt counseling instead of maxing out your credit cards if you find yourself in a financial bind.
